手机版

jQuery获取表中一列的值(推荐)

时间:2021-09-05 来源:互联网 编辑:宝哥软件园 浏览:

写这篇博文的时候,发现自己之前写过《获取DataTable选择第一行某一列值》 http://www.cnblogs.com/insus/p/5434062.html。

但是和这篇文章说的完全不一样。这个Insus.NET需要的是jQuery来获取html表的一行和一列的数据。

下表:

Html代码:

table tr th style=' width :10 px;'输入id='全选'类型='复选框'/第/第/第费用项/第费用说明/第费用明细/第货币/第样式='宽度:50 px;'operation/th/tr @ foreach(var m in new highway additional chargeen tity()。highway additional charges()){ tr class=' trData ' Td input id=' class=' selectsing ' type=' checkbox ' value=' @ m . highway additional charge _ NBR '/Td @ m . highway additional charge _ NBR/Td td@m.Item/tdtd@m.Description/tdtd@m.Itemizations/tdtd@m.Currency/td Td input class=' select ' id=' button select ' type=' button ' value=' select '//Td/tr }/table当用户单击某一行最后一列中的“select”按钮时,他希望获取该行中某一列的数据

因苏。NET具有如图所示的列和索引。索引从0开始。如果要获取“费用名称”列的值,该列的列索引为2。

演示:

在上文中,我们使用了。text()方法获取值。但是在某些时候,如果您想要获取一个列的值,也就是html代码,那么我们可以使用。html()方法。下面Insus.NET稍作修改:

演示:

事实上,使用索引获取值只是一种方法,但在Insus.NET并不是最好的方法。因为数据行是动态呈现的,所以列也可能改变。因此,Insus.NET仍然习惯于用文体类来实现:

例如,如果您想要获取“费用解释”列的值,请在该列中添加一个类:

JQuery代码:

演示:

上面提到的是边肖介绍的jQuery得到了Table中一列的值,希望对大家有所帮助。如果你有任何问题,请给我留言,边肖会及时回复你。非常感谢您对我们网站的支持!

版权声明:jQuery获取表中一列的值(推荐)是由宝哥软件园云端程序自动收集整理而来。如果本文侵犯了你的权益,请联系本站底部QQ或者邮箱删除。